A leading global legal business is looking for an experienced Associate with expertise in Clinical Negligence to join their Healthcare Team in Manchester. The role involves managing a diverse portfolio of Clinical Negligence cases, providing legal advice, and collaborating with clients and medical professionals.
Candidates must have at least 3 years PQE in NHS Resolution Clinical Negligence. The position offers a competitive rewards package and hybrid working options.
